Leptospermum ‘Pageant’ (Tea Tree)

Leptospermum ‘Pageant’ is a spectacular tea tree variety renowned for its vibrant, multi-toned flowers that range from deep pink to rich red. Compact, hardy, and incredibly floriferous, it creates a stunning spring show while remaining easy to grow and suitable for a wide range of gardens.


🌱 Why Gardeners Love Leptospermum ‘Pageant’

Show-stopping flower colour - Produces masses of vivid pink to red blooms for a dramatic display.
Compact and tidy growth - Ideal for borders, small gardens, and container features.
Pollinator attracting - Bees and beneficial insects flock to its nectar-rich blossoms.
Hardy & adaptable - Performs well in sandy, coastal, and low-maintenance landscapes.
Reliable spring performer - Offers a heavy flowering flush with minimal care.


🏡 How to Use Leptospermum ‘Pageant’ in Your Garden

Feature shrub - Its brilliant floral display makes it a standout focal point.
Garden borders & edging - Adds colour, texture, and compact structure.
Low hedging - Forms an attractive small hedge with regular light pruning.
Coastal & native gardens - Thrives in tough conditions, including wind and sandy soil.


Easy Planting & Care Guide

  • Spacing: Plant 80cm to 1 metre apart when creating a low hedge, or provide more room for feature plantings.

  • Best Planting Time: Can be planted year-round, best season is autumn.

  • Mulching & Fertilising: This plant thrives naturally and does not require mulching or fertiliser to stay healthy.


❔ FAQs About Leptospermum ‘Pageant’

How tall does ‘Pageant’ grow?
It typically grows 1 to 1.5 metres tall with a neat, rounded shape.

When does it flower?
It produces an abundant display of brightly coloured blooms in spring.

Is it drought tolerant?
Yes, once established it performs very well in low-water gardens.

Can it be grown near the coast?
Absolutely, it's highly tolerant of salt spray, sandy soils, and wind.

Does it need pruning?
Only light pruning after flowering is recommended to maintain shape and encourage bushiness.
